Just a question

Tue, 2013-06-25 14:51

What do you mean by winged. I understand gilled and gutted, and I read that winged mean either the chest area (ie wings like in snapper and dhus- yum) or fins.

Just wondering because either way I find it makes filleting fish much harder (even gilled and gutted IMO)

the answer

Tue, 2013-06-25 16:24

G'day crasny1,
about a month ago, I landed my first mulloway and it had been laying on the jetty for about half n hour now and it had already been gilled and gutted, then an old guy came up to me and said:
you gonna take the wings off that? I said why, he said they have a stink gland in them that goes through the whole body and makes the fish taste crap, so now once I catch them, I cut there wings off aswell, hang them over night and fillet them in the morning, by doing this the mulloway have tasted bloody awesome

Don't waste the wings

Tue, 2013-06-25 16:33

 Don't waste the wings all you have todo is cut the stink glands out the black things behind the fins on the wings still then it hasn't made any difference to the many mullaway I have caught the wings are one of the best parts
